Abstract

PURPOSE:To raise the flexibility of a glove by increasing its resilience by a method in which a latex or paste is mixed with a powdered natural rubber, a powdered synthetic rubber, etc., and the mixture is molded by a dip molding method. CONSTITUTION:A vinyl chloride paste is mixed with a powdered synthetic rubber to prepare a molding material. A mold 1 for glove is dipped into the molding material and pulled up, and the film 2 adhered to the surface of the mold 1 for glove is gelled. The gelled film 2 is peeled off from the mold 1 to obtain a complete product. Usually, 10-20% powdered rubber is mixed into the vinyl chloride paste. The elasticity modulus of the glove can thus be lowered, the flexibility of the glove is raised, and the glove can easily fit fingers when wearing.
